When exploring the vegetable seed industry in Norway, several key considerations come into play. First, understanding the regulatory landscape is crucial, as Norway has strict regulations regarding seed quality and plant health, governed by the Norwegian Food Safety Authority. Compliance with these regulations is necessary for market access. The unique climate in Norway, characterized by short growing seasons and varying daylight hours, poses challenges for seed production, making it essential to select varieties that can thrive under such conditions. Additionally, the increasing focus on sustainability and organic farming presents significant opportunities for companies that provide environmentally friendly seed options. The competitive landscape is influenced by both local and international players, necessitating a thorough analysis of competitors and market trends. Furthermore, Norway's commitment to food security and self-sufficiency can drive demand for high-quality vegetable seeds. Understanding global market relevance is also important, as trends in consumer preferences, such as the rise of plant-based diets, can impact the industry. Addressing environmental concerns, particularly related to biodiversity and climate change, is vital for sustainable practices. Overall, thorough research into these factors will provide valuable insights for anyone looking to engage with the vegetable seed industry in Norway.
